American history theme park in The Bronx 1960-1964 On June 19, 1960, America was introduced to a unique theme park.
Unlike those that came before it and certainly never duplicated since, Freedomland U.S.A. incorporated American history into family entertainment. In the northeast part of the New York City borough of The Bronx, Freedomland U.S.A. was billed as "the world’s largest entertainment center." Space City USA (Huntsville, Alabama) was one of the many post-Disney theme parks that opened, started construction but stalled or never moved beyond initial planning.
We have posted about the park in the past since the creative team featured a Freedomland connection. The creators said it “would have compared to Disneyland and Freedomland.” Thomas Glenn Robinson was involved with creation/construction. His resume credited work with Freedomland.
The park recently was in the spotlight in an email newsletter by Rivershore Press. Excerpt:
“Construction began in 1964, and enough progress was made that there were a few buildings and a functional railroad…everyone kept trying to follow progress toward blastoff. They waited. And waited. By 1967 things were looking no better, with what little had been built just sitting and rotting away, including the magnificent train. The whole venture was abandoned, whether due to poor planning, financial misbehaving, or lack of experience, we don’t really know.”

The “Freedomland Eagle” and this shop bag are the latest additions to the park collection. The items originally were located with another unknown item (lot 1408) at Reed’s Antiques & Collectibles in Wells, Maine, on April 19, 2003. The cost of the three items was $12.
The purchaser also obtained a Freedomland guide (lot 1406 - unknown if it was the 1960 or 1962 version) for $16.
